Aberdeen

Aberdeen, MD, US - ABE-0

Image credit: Unsplash

Aberdeen is a small Maryland city between Baltimore and Philadelphia. The city developed around the U.S. Army Proving Ground established at the site in 1917, and to this day, Aberdeen is a vital center for military research and development. Baseball fans also know Aberdeen as the home of the Minor League IronBirds, who play in Ripken Stadium.

When visiting Aberdeen, one of the best spots for outdoor recreation is Susquehanna State Park in nearby Havre de Grace, Maryland. This park bordering the Susquehanna River offers excellent fishing, boating, camping, and hiking trails. The Bulle Rock Golf Course hosts a well-mown outdoor activity closer to downtown Aberdeen if you want to practice your swing. Step back in time at Steppingstone Farm Museum, or sample the blueberry wine at Mount Felix Vineyard & Winery.

Greyhound serves a handful of routes to Aberdeen, but Amtrak provides most of the service to Aberdeen via train. Northeast Regional trains stop in Aberdeen multiple times each day on the routes between Boston and Virginia Beach. Train travel from Aberdeen makes it easy to spend a weekend in New York, Philadelphia, or Washington after just a quick ride. Air travelers can also take an Amtrak train to Wilmington or Baltimore to connect to the nearest airports: Wilmington Philadelphia Regional Airport and BWI Marshall Airport.

As the most populous city in New Jersey, Newark offers some excellent museums, parks and restaurants that you can enjoy year-round. Art lovers should stop by the famous Newark Museum to enjoy a rich collection of works by American artists and sculptors. History buffs should check out the New Jersey Historical Society for ongoing exhibitions documenting the state’s rich history.

Located by the Passaic River, Newark offers various places where you can enjoy a relaxing stroll by the water. For the best views, head over to the city’s Riverfront Park near the hip Ironbound neighborhood. If you’re seeking more outdoor enjoyment, check out Branch Brook Park where you will find various lakes and plenty of cherry blossoms.

Newark is one of the biggest travel hubs in the United States, which makes it very easily accessible via all types of transportation. The Newark Liberty International Airport is one of the three airports that serves the New York City metro area, and its close proximity to Newark’s Penn Station makes it easy to reach from anywhere via bus or train.

Where is the train station in Newark?

Newark Penn Station - NWKPNS-0

Image credit: Ken Lund

Link to image attribution

Main arrival station: Newark Penn Station

Not to be confused with the Penn Station in New York City just 10 miles away, Newark’s Penn Station is a vital regional transportation hub which serves the greater New York City and New Jersey area. Located a few blocks East of the central business district in Newark, Penn Station opened in 1935, when its Art Deco architecture was at the height of fashion - see if you can spot the Zodiac signs decorating the chandeliers! Travelers can access Amtrak intercity passenger trains running on the busy Northeast Corridor between Washington D.C. and Boston, as well as intercity buses like Greyhound and Fullington Trailways. Local transit available at Penn Station includes Newark Light Rail, Port Authority Trans-Hudson (PATH) rapid transit linking Newark to Manhattan, and NJ Transit commuter trains serving coastal and central New Jersey.
